CentOS 7을 실행하는 테스트 가상 머신 파티션이 있습니다. 이 특정 파티션에는 많은 구성이 있습니다. 일부 특정 구성을 잊어버렸습니다.
이 virtualbox 파티션을 3대의 새 컴퓨터로 전송해야 합니다. 참고: virtualbox 이미지가 아닙니다. 기본적으로 CentOS 7을 동일한 방식으로 실행하는 새 컴퓨터 3대를 구입하세요.
가장 빠르고 좋은 방법은 무엇입니까?
답변1
파티션을 호스트 디스크에 쓴 다음 rsync를 사용하고 3번을 병렬로 실행합니다. 운 좋게도 호스트는 디스크에서 데이터를 네트워크에 넣기 전에 한 번만 읽습니다. 이것은 나에게 잘 작동합니다.
다른 3개의 머신이 서로 시드할 수 있도록 브로드캐스팅하거나 일부 시드를 설정할 수도 있지만, 정기적으로 수행하지 않는 한 그렇게 하면 작업 속도가 빨라지고 오버헤드가 많이 발생할 것 같지 않습니다.
답변2
- 복사할 머신을 종료합니다.
- 새 머신 생성
- 기존 머신의 가상 디스크를 새 머신에 추가
- 새 머신을 부팅하고 이를 사용하여
ddrescue
복사할 파티션의 이미지를 생성합니다. - 이미지를 실제 머신으로 전송
- 재사용을 위해 이미지를
ddrescue
새 머신의 디스크에 복사합니다. - 이전 VM을 복원하고 바로 이동하세요.